This book will help anyone with a professional or academic interest in the culture sector understand the distinct strategic questions that apply to it and how the specific circumstances of the cultural sector affect organisational leadership.

An Adobe DRM-protected file is different than a pdf file in that it uses Adobe DRM (Digital Rights Management) technology, which authors and publishers use to protect their content from illegal online distribution and to set certain privileges such as restrictions on copying and printing.
